Output 21a44f0f5a69e0af04ad3f3f8f13ace7b9388db04897b43c68dc5daf03524fc5:0

value
17553692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5dbaf4b763860fcf4a6eca5a5c6d76b94a1af7e7 OP_EQUALVERIFY OP_CHECKSIG
address
19YbomQAnVXoU6tneZbfySkPuxiLV93U8Y
transaction
21a44f0f5a69e0af04ad3f3f8f13ace7b9388db04897b43c68dc5daf03524fc5
spent
true